WebNov 1, 2024 · MEANING AND DEFINITION OF NEGOTIABLE INSTRUMENT. The word ‘Negotiable’ means transferable from one person to another, and the term ‘instrument’ means a document of title of money(as described by Prof. Goode).. A negotiable Instrument was required to avoid high cash transactions and give legal effect to such an instrument; … Webcompensation. 1 a monetary payment for loss or damage. 2 in Scotland, the right to set off one debt against another with the effect of reducing the one by the amount of the other. The right is not available after decree. It applies only to liquid debts or, at the discretion of the court, debts easily made liquid.
